Hi everyone I am working on a modern Team Site. I have followed the instructions https://docs.microsoft.com/en-us/sharepoint/dev/declarative-customization/column-formatting#create-a-button-to-launch-a-flow to create a button in a document library to run a flow on a specific document, and this works perfectly in the library. However, I also have a page where there is a document library web part and I want users to be able to run the flow using this button from this page. This doesn't seem to be possible as the button does nothing when clicked on the web part. From what I've read it doesn't look like there's any workaround for this so I wanted to double check that no-one else has found a way around it. These pages show multiple document libraries so I don't really want to have to ask the users to go into each library every time they want to run the flows. I'd be grateful if anyone has any pointers or has come across this issue themselves. Thanks in advance.13KViews0likes19Comments
